just-in-time: inventory arrives when production needs it

Just-in-time, or JIT, is a production control discipline in which materials, components, and subassemblies arrive at the assembly line or work station at the exact moment they are needed, not before. The practice eliminates the intermediate storage and handling that traditional batch manufacturing requires. Instead of maintaining weeks or months of buffer stock in warehouses, a JIT operation receives frequent, smaller deliveries timed to match the production schedule.

The core mechanics depend on two elements: predictable, stable demand and reliable supplier performance. A manufacturer using JIT must forecast production accurately and communicate that forecast to suppliers with enough lead time for them to ship. Suppliers, in turn, must meet tight delivery windows without fail. Most JIT operations use a pull system, where the production line signals when material is needed, rather than a push system where material is sent speculatively. Kanban cards or electronic signals often trigger these pulls.

JIT operates at different scales. Some manufacturers apply it only to high-value items or bulky materials where storage costs are significant. Others, particularly in automotive and electronics, commit to company-wide JIT systems that govern everything from raw materials to finished goods. The automotive industry pioneered JIT in the 1970s; Toyota's system became the benchmark. JIT works best for products with stable demand and moderate complexity. Industries with long lead times, seasonal demand, or volatile sourcing face greater difficulty implementing it.

The main risks are supply chain disruption and quality failure. If a single supplier misses a delivery window by hours, the production line may stop. A defective batch arriving just-in-time becomes a defect arriving just-in-time, with no inspection buffer to catch it before assembly. Quality control and supplier management are therefore inseparable from JIT discipline. Many operations implement some safety stock of critical, long-lead items as insurance against catastrophic failure.

The financial and operational benefits are real: lower warehouse costs, reduced obsolescence, faster product turns, and less working capital tied up in inventory. The trade-off is operational fragility and dependence on supplier reliability. JIT is not a universal solution; it is a deliberate choice to reduce waste at the expense of redundancy, suited to stable, high-volume manufacturing environments with mature supply chains.
